Easy Access Pensions Saver (Issue 4)

Can HTB change the interest rate?

  • This is a managed variable rate, which means it is set by us and we can change it at any time
  • If we increase the interest rate, we’ll make the change and let you know
  • If we reduce the interest rate, we’ll let you know at least 30 days before.

What would the estimated balance be after 12 months based on certain deposits?

  • £100,000 invested in this account would earn £3,750.00 interest
  • This is for illustrative purposes only and assumes interest is paid and compounded annually. The illustrative example does not consider the individual circumstances of a customer.

How do I open and manage the account?

  • You can open an account by completing an application form. We will complete some checks on the SSAS/SIPP Administrator and underlying member(s) and let you know if we need anything else to help complete your application
  • Once your account is open, you can manage it through our Specialist Deposits team by email on corporate.deposits@htb.co.uk
  • You’ll need the minimum balance of £25,000 in the account to open it and keep it open
  • The maximum account balance is £5,000,000, excluding interest.

Can I withdraw money?

  • Yes – this is an easy access account, so you can make unlimited withdrawals.

Additional information

  • You have 14 days from the date you applied for the account to fund it. If the account remains unfunded at 14 days, it will be closed
  • All payments must be made to – and from – your nominated bank account or into another account with us
